KO vs WMK: Which Is the Better Dividend Stock?
As of July 2026, KO (The Coca-Cola Company) screens as the stronger dividend stock, winning 5 of 8 head-to-head metrics. KO offers the higher yield at 2.40%, WMK has the higher dividend-safety score, and WMK trades at the larger discount to fair value (-12%).
| Metric | KO | WMK |
|---|---|---|
| Forward yield | 2.40% | 1.77% |
| Annual dividend | $2.12 | $1.36 |
| Payout ratio | 65% | 34% |
| Years of growth | 55 yr | 0 yr |
| 5-yr dividend growth | 4.5% | 1.9% |
| 5-yr total return | 46% | 29% |
| Dividend safety score | 92 (A) | 99 (A) |
| Fair value estimate | $50.52 | $64.21 |
| Upside to fair value | -39% | -12% |
| Frequency | quarterly | quarterly |
| Market cap | $383.3B | $1.9B |
| P/E ratio | 27.8 | 19.2 |
